Burna Boy headlines, Ayra Starr & Oxlade perform at day 1 of Afronation Portugal

The Afronation festival has grown to become one of the biggest exports of Afrobeats; taking Nigerian music to different parts of the world for listeners to connect with the music. The concert has taken place in different parts of the world with recent stops in Miami United States and now Portugal.

The latest stop for the festival at Portugal boasts of an impressive lineup of multiple acts including Burna Boy, Ayra Starr, and Oxlade who were also joined by Jamaica’s Popcaan, Ghana’s Camidoh, Malian-French star Aya Nakamura, and Cape Verdian star Soraia Ramos.

On the lineup are also South African stars such as Maphorisa, DBN Gogo, Tyler ICU, Pabi Cooper, and Daliwonga who gave the Portugal fans a captivating Amapiano experience.

Burna Boy who headlined the opening day thrilled listeners with a collection of his hit singles including ‘Last Last’, ‘YE’, ‘Killin Dem’, and ‘For My Hand’.

Afronation has announced that the concert would be coming to Nigeria this year at what would be their first stop in Nigeria. The announcement was made on social media on June 9, 2023.
